Question 1139757: Find the indicated limit, if it exists.(7 points)
limit of f of x as x approaches 0 where f of x equals 7 minus x squared when x is less than 0, 7 when x equals 0, and 10 x plus 7 when x is greater than 0
choices below


3

10

7

The limit does not exist.

f(x) = 7-x^2 when x<0 So for this 'piece' of the piecewise function, as x --> 0 (from the left) f(x) approaches 7
f(x) = 7 at x=0
f(x) = 10x+7 for x>0 so as X ---> 0 from the right, this approaches 7 as well.
Since the left and right limits are equal, the limit is 7,and would still be 7 even if we have a hole at x=0.
